Apesar de terem atividade baixa, devem ter acesso controlado e manuseio adequado. Esse artigo visa avaliar, por meio da simula\u00e7\u00e3o computacional, os coeficientes de convers\u00e3o para dose equivalente e efetiva por dois objetos simuladores virtuais antropom\u00f3rficos, FASH3 (Female Adult MeSH) e MASH3 (Male Adult MeSH), durante uma aula pr\u00e1tica de um laborat\u00f3rio did\u00e1tico utilizando uma fonte de Am-241.
